Official Description (provided by the hotel):
Recommended & conveniently located on the Trail, 4/10/20/30 minutes to the airport, downtown Charlottetown, PEI beaches & Cavendish. Comfortable describes our 2 rooms with 2 singles, a full bath/shower and sitting room. The B&B also has 2 rooms with doubles on the main floor, 2 baths and sitting room. This is a private bath for a family renting two rooms. Package PEI starts with a tea pot tour of our organic perennial gardens, following with the best tea, scones & cream at Grandma's Tea Room (on premises) ending with a make and take scrapbook event sure to please. ... more   less
